Information about the IELTS test
At Armidale, we aim to provide all 4 test modules on the same day, i.e. on the Saturday test date listed. However, local candidates may be required to do their Speaking interviews on the Friday preceding the Saturday test date.
Registration for the Listening, Reading and Writing modules starts at 08:00 am and closes at 08:45, and the test starts at 09:00 sharp.
The morning's session finishes about 12:15 pm. Then there is a break, and the first Speaking interviews start at 1:30 pm. Each Speaking interview takes about 15 minutes, and candidates should arrive to register about 10 minutes before their test time. The final Speaking interviews usually finish by 6:30 pm at the latest.
When we receive your application and your place is confirmed, we will email you and then we will send a letter with your Speaking test time and Candidate number 2-3 weeks before the test date.

Cancellations, Transfers & Refunds
Please email the IELTS Office as soon as you know you need to cancel a test date or you may not get a refund.
Cancellations made before the cancellation cut-off date (6 Fridays before the test date) will receive a full refund. Cancellations made after the closing date will not receive a refund, unless there is a serious cause, such as hospitalisation, bereavement or accident. Cancellations made after the cut-off date may be charged a $50 administration fee.
Please contact the IELTS Office as soon as possible if you miss your IELTS test due to illness or accident, as you will need to complete the Request for Refund form within 5 working days of the test date and provide a doctor's medical certificate or other information.
Requests to transfer to another test date can only be made for the next available test date. If you wish to transfer to any other test than the next one, you have to request a refund and make another booking. If the transfer request is received before the cancellation cut-off date, no fee will be charged. Transfer requests received after the cancellation cut-off date will be treated as cancellations, and will receive no refund.
Please use the web-form above to contact the IELTS Office if you wish to transfer to another test date, as you will need to confirm the availability of seats in the test you wish to transfer to.

Enquiry on Results
If you are not satisfied with your IELTS Test Results, you have 6 weeks after the test date to make an enquiry on results. Please download the Enquiry on Results form, and then fill in and return the form to the Armidale IELTS Office with the following:
- Your original test results form (a new test result form will be issued to you when your new results have been determined).
- Payment of $176 (included $16 GST) made to "University of New England" (bank cheque or money order), or download and send a Credit Card Authority form.

Do not send your form to IELTS Australia in Canberra. If you do, it will delay the process by up to one week, as they have to send the form back to us for us to arrange copies of your original test materials which are stored at our Centre.
If your marks are changed, we will refund you $160 (i.e. less the GST). Please use our Electronic Bank Details form to send us your details for a refund. If it is a non-Australian bank account, please contact our office.
Once we receive your request for a re-mark, the process takes 4-6 weeks. We strongly advise against getting your Listening and Reading modules re-marked as these modules are always marked twice by our examiners, and there has not been a change in Listening or Reading scores for the last 2 years. Requesting a re-mark of Listening and Reading will delay the return of your Enquiry on Results.
